Position Description
TheSchool of Music ( seeks to develop a pool of candidates for possible temporary/non-tenured faculty to teach music courses. New hires will join a nationally recognized department with a dynamic faculty dedicated to a collaborative and innovative approach to teaching undergraduate and graduate students.
Temporary/non-tenured faculty are appointed to teach one to four courses per semester. Teaching appointments are based upon student demand on a semester-by-semester basis. Eligibility for annual reappointment is contingent upon satisfactory annual performance evaluations during the term period, in addition to continuity of funding and departmental need.
This posting is for the fall 2025, spring 2026, and summer 2025/2026 semesters. Please note that this posting is not intended to convey that such a need currently exists. Applicants applying for a pool faculty position will be available to the departmental search committee for consideration in case the need arises.
All positions are subject to availability of funds.
Required Qualifications
Specific educational requirements vary by position, but a minimum of a bachelor’s degree or commensurate experience is required.
Preferred Qualifications
Master’s degree in music, or equivalent professional experience, and/or prior teaching experience is preferred.
